How they compare

S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ries currently reports 0.6% against 0.6% in Viet Nam, a difference of 0.0%.

That makes S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ries's figure about 1.1 times Viet Nam's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 21 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Viet Nam ahead.

S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ries ranks 21st and Viet Nam ranks 20th of 221 groups.

Across the 4 decades both report, S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ries averaged higher in 1 and Viet Nam in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ries Viet Nam Difference Ahead
1990s 0.0% 0.2% 0.2% Viet Nam
2000s 0.1% 0.3% 0.2% Viet Nam
2010s 0.3% 0.6% 0.3% Viet Nam
2020s 0.6% 0.6% 0.0% SDG: Landlocked Developing Countries

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
